-----BEGIN PGP SIGNED MESSAGE----- Hash: SHA512 # SSA-940889: Vulnerabilities in the embedded FTP server of SIMATIC CP 1543-1 Publication Date: 2020-02-11 Last Update: 2020-02-11 Current Version: 1.0 CVSS v3.1 Base Score: 9.8 SUMMARY ======= The latest update for SIMATIC CP 1543-1 contains two fixes for vulnerabilities within its embedded ProFTPD FTP server. The more severe of these vulnerabilities could allow for remote code execution and information disclosure without authentication. Siemens has released updates for SIMATIC CP 1543-1 modules. AFFECTED PRODUCTS AND SOLUTION ============================== * SIMATIC CP 1543-1 (incl. SIPLUS NET variants) - Affected versions: All Versions >= V2.0 and < V2.2 - Remediation: Update to V2.2 - Download: https://support.industry.siemens.com/cs/ww/en/view/109775642 WORKAROUNDS AND MITIGATIONS =========================== Siemens has identified the following specific workarounds and mitigations that customers can apply to reduce the risk: * Disable the embedded FTP server. The server is deactivated in the default configuration. * Limit access to port 21/tcp to trusted IP addresses. Additional information on Industrial Security by Siemens can be found at: https://www.siemens.com/industrialsecurity PRODUCT DESCRIPTION =================== The SIMATIC CP 1543-1 communication processor connects the S7-1500 controller to Ethernet networks. It provides integrated security functions such as firewall, Virtual Private Networks (VPN) and support of other protocols with data encryption such as FTPs. The communication processor protects S7-1500 stations against unauthorized access, as well as integrity and confidentiality of transmitted data. SIPLUS extreme products are designed for reliable operation under extreme conditions and are based on SIMATIC, LOGO!, SITOP, SINAMICS, SIMOTION, SCALANCE or other devices. SIPLUS devices use the same firmware as the product they are based on. A detailed list of CWE classes can be found at: https://cwe.mitre.org/. * Vulnerability CVE-2019-12815 An arbitrary file copy vulnerability in mod_copy of the embedded FTP server allowes for remote code execution and information disclosure without authentication, a related issue to CVE-2015-3306. CVSS v3.1 Base Score: 9.8 CVSS V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H/E:P/RL:O/RC:C CWE: CWE-284: Improper Access Control * Vulnerability CVE-2019-18217 The embedded FTP server allowes remote unauthenticated denial-of-service due to incorrect handling of overly long commands because execution in a child process enters an infinite loop.
